Responsibilities


Reporting to the Head of Treasury (Accounting), Specific duties and responsibilities shall be as follows:
  • Verification of payment vouchers and committal documents
  • Data capture in IFMIS system
  • Maintenance of Primary records e.g. Cash Books, Ledgers, Vote Books and preparation of Management Reports
  • Safe custody of government records and assets under him/her
  • Writing cheques and posting payments and receipt vouchers in the Cash Books
  • posting of Payments in IFMIS system
